aboutsummaryrefslogtreecommitdiffstats
path: root/R/build_portfolios.R
diff options
context:
space:
mode:
Diffstat (limited to 'R/build_portfolios.R')
-rw-r--r--R/build_portfolios.R6
1 files changed, 4 insertions, 2 deletions
diff --git a/R/build_portfolios.R b/R/build_portfolios.R
index f2657658..8acc94a3 100644
--- a/R/build_portfolios.R
+++ b/R/build_portfolios.R
@@ -13,7 +13,8 @@ if(.Platform$OS.type == "unix"){
source(file.path(code.dir, "code", "R", "intex_deal_functions.R"), chdir=TRUE)
source(file.path(code.dir, "code", "R", "yieldcurve.R"))
source(file.path(code.dir, "code", "R", "serenitasdb.R"))
-index <- load.index("hy21")
+source(file.path(code.dir, "code", "R", "creditIndex.R"))
+
if(length(args) >=2){
argslist <- strsplit(args[-1], ",")
@@ -34,7 +35,8 @@ if(length(args) >= 1){
calibration.date <- addBusDay(workdate, -1)
exportYC(calibration.date)
-
+index <- creditIndex("hy21")
+index <- set.index.desc(index, calibration.date)
global.params <- yaml.load_file(file.path(root.dir, "code", "etc", "params.yml"))
cusipdata <- cusip.data()